Foxboro FBM204 P0914SY Thermocouple Input Module
The Foxboro FBM204 with part number P0914SY is a thermocouple input module for Foxboro I/A‑Series DCS systems. It collects millivolt signals from field thermocouple sensors and converts weak thermoelectric signals into accurate temperature digital values for DCS control and monitoring. It is widely used for high‑temperature measurement in petrochemical, chemical and power‑generation process sites.

This rack‑mount plug‑in module supports multiple thermocouple types and comes with cold‑junction compensation function to ensure measurement accuracy. Each channel provides galvanic isolation to resist field‑site electrical interference. Front‑panel LED indicators reflect module operation and fault status. It exchanges data with DCS main controller via FBM backplane bus. As obsolete aftermarket spare parts, it is widely applied for DCS cabinet maintenance and retrofitting projects.

Core Functions
- Receive weak millivolt thermoelectric signals output by field thermocouple sensors.
- Built‑in cold‑junction compensation function eliminates temperature measurement deviation caused by terminal temperature change.
- Complete high‑precision signal processing and analog‑to‑digital conversion to obtain real‑time temperature values.
- Channel‑wise galvanic isolation suppresses common‑mode interference and protects internal DCS circuits.
- Transmit converted temperature data to I/A‑Series DCS controller through FBM backplane bus.
- Detect field‑loop open‑circuit and short‑circuit faults, upload alarm information for process monitoring and interlock control.

FAQ
- Q: Can FBM204 P0914SY work independently without Foxboro DCS rack and controller?
A: It must be installed in FBM rack and cooperate with DCS main controller, cannot complete thermocouple signal acquisition as standalone hardware. - Q: What are typical module failure symptoms?
A: Temperature reading drift, abnormal value jumping, no measured value output, fault LED alarm, inconsistent reading between field sensor and DCS display. Q: How to complete commissioning and diagnosis?
A: Inspect rack power supply and field thermocouple wiring; input standard millivolt signal, verify temperature reading on DCS workstation.
